One of the key advantages of attending a private sixth form is the smaller class sizes. In public schools, class sizes can often be large, making it difficult for students to receive individualized attention and support. private sixth forms typically have smaller class sizes, allowing for more personalized interaction between students and teachers. This can lead to a more engaging and effective learning experience, as teachers are better able to tailor their teaching methods to the needs of each student.
Additionally, private sixth forms often have a more specialized curriculum that is designed to prepare students for the specific challenges of their chosen career path or further education. This can be especially beneficial for students who have a clear idea of what they want to study in college or pursue as a career, as they can receive specialized training and preparation in their chosen field. For example, a private sixth form that focuses on STEM subjects may offer advanced courses in math and science, as well as opportunities for hands-on research and internships.
private sixth forms also tend to offer a wider range of extracurricular activities and enrichment opportunities than public schools. These activities can help students develop important skills such as leadership, teamwork, and time management, as well as provide valuable experiences that can enhance college applications. Whether it’s joining a sports team, participating in a drama production, or volunteering in the community, private sixth forms offer students the chance to explore their interests and passions outside of the classroom.
Furthermore, private sixth forms often have better resources and facilities than public schools, allowing students to learn in a more modern and well-equipped environment. From state-of-the-art science labs to dedicated art studios, private sixth forms provide students with the tools they need to succeed in their studies. Additionally, private sixth forms may also offer access to additional support services such as career counseling, university application assistance, and academic tutoring, ensuring that students have the guidance and support they need to excel.
Another benefit of choosing a private sixth form education is the sense of community and camaraderie that often exists within these institutions. Because private sixth forms are smaller and more specialized, students have the opportunity to form close relationships with their peers and teachers. This sense of community can foster a supportive and nurturing environment where students feel valued and respected, leading to a more positive and fulfilling educational experience.
